Join us for the launch of the Friends of Chamberlain Reynolds Memorial Forest, a group based in working with the community to approach the challenges that arise when managing a multi-use community-based forest. This first meeting's purpose is to hear from you about your experiences recreating in the forest. Come prepared to share what you love about the forest and any suggestions you have for improving the forest's management. Follow-up meetings will be held monthly, so keep an eye on the website for future dates.

Chamberlain Reynolds Memorial Forest is one of the most cherished and used trail networks in the watershed. The gentle terrain of the forest makes it accessible to a wide range of users, welcoming those looking for a leisurely stroll, a beach to visit with their family, or a place to walk their dogs. The charming character of the property and its many opportunities for wildlife viewing make it a fantastic place to get outside, move, and connect with nature.
